package expr
import (
"errors"
"github.com/genjidb/genji/document"
"github.com/genjidb/genji/internal/environment"
"github.com/genjidb/genji/types"
)
// A Path is an expression that extracts a value from a document at a given path.
type Path document.Path
// Eval extracts the current value from the environment and returns the value stored at p.
// It implements the Expr interface.
func (p Path) Eval(env *environment.Environment) (types.Value, error) {
if len(p) == 0 {
return NullLiteral, nil
}
d, ok := env.GetDocument()
if !ok {
return NullLiteral, document.ErrFieldNotFound
}
dp := document.Path(p)
v, ok := env.Get(dp)
if ok {
return v, nil
}
v, err := dp.GetValueFromDocument(d)
if err == document.ErrFieldNotFound {
return NullLiteral, nil
}
return v, err
}
// IsEqual compares this expression with the other expression and returns
// true if they are equal.
func (p Path) IsEqual(other Expr) bool {
if other == nil {
return false
}
o, ok := other.(Path)
if !ok {
return false
}
return document.Path(p).IsEqual(document.Path(o))
}
func (p Path) String() string {
return document.Path(p).String()
}
// A Wildcard is an expression that iterates over all the fields of a document.
type Wildcard struct{}
func (w Wildcard) String() string {
return "*"
}
func (w Wildcard) Eval(env *environment.Environment) (types.Value, error) {
return nil, errors.New("no table specified")
}
// Iterate call the document iterate method.
func (w Wildcard) Iterate(env environment.Environment, fn func(field string, value types.Value) error) error {
d, ok := env.GetDocument()
if !ok {
return errors.New("no table specified")
}
return d.Iterate(fn)
}
